Attch 4 - AGILITeE Lab Tour Registration Form Attch 3 - Map to Truman Gate and Bldg 760 Attch 2 - AGILITeE Contents of a Visit Request Attch 1 - AGILITeE Lab Tour Agenda AGILITeE Lab Tour 2017 Announcement Advanced Gas and Illuminator Laser Innovative Technical Effort (AGILITeE) FA9451-17-S-0009 Call 0001 Laboratory Tour 2017 Introduction The Air Force Research Laboratory, Directed Energy Directorate, Laser Division (AFRL/RDL) will host a Laboratory Tour at Kirtland AFB, NM on 19 Oct 2017. The tour will provide a comprehensive summary of the "Advanced Gas and Illuminator Laser Innovative Technical Effort (AGILITeE)" acquisition (FA9451-17-S-0009 Call 0001). The purpose of AGILITeE is to pursue research and development (R&D) of high energy gas lasers and illuminator laser sources to provide technology options to meet current and future warfighter needs. Objective The objective of the tour is to provide a timely update to industry on the mission and vision of the AGILITeE effort. It provides a forum for industry to gain knowledge and insight into the research and development AFRL/RDL is pursuing by providing a thorough and comprehensive presentation of AGILITeE's technical objectives. The tour will include the Lamberson Laser Facility (Bldg. 760) and the Davis Advanced Laser Facility (Bldg 761).
